The Trade Speculation
The idea of the 49ers acquiring Maxx Crosby has been a hot topic among NFL insiders and fans alike. The writer at 49erswebzone.com suggests that the Raiders have indeed attempted to trade Crosby this offseason, and while the offer isn't as enticing as the one from Baltimore, it's still a substantial package: a first-round pick, a Day 2 pick, and a former first-round selection in Mykel Williams. This proposal highlights the Raiders' commitment to rebuilding and the potential value they see in Crosby.
